My skins really dry, but moisturizers make it too oily... Any suggestions?

I've tried a few different moisturizers but they only cover the problem and dont fix it, and then my skins really oily by mid-day.

Hmmm im guessing your oily-est places on your face is your T-zone (your nose and chin area) leaving your forehead and cheeks feeling dry. i have the same problem too if so. i simply fix it by not apply moisturizer to my T-zone and but everywhere else. 12 Sep 2009 / 0

You might need to find an oil-free moisturizer. Where is the area that gets oily by mid day? if it is your face, that is rather normal.. you can use oil blotting paper when that happens. You can also carry that with you all day so you can remove excess oil whenever. But if it is your body then you will probably need to look for a light body moisturizer. 12 Sep 2009 / 0
